Jayden Dance extends loan deal with Liverpool to join Championship club Sunderland

Premier League club Liverpool have announced that they have renewed their contract with Jaden Dance and will loan him to Championship club Sunderland until the end of the 2024-25 season.


The 19-year-old Dans came from Liverpool's youth training camp and made his debut under Jurgen Klopp in February last year. Dans then went through Liverpool's youth training system and was promoted to the first team. He has played 9 times for Liverpool's first team and scored 3 goals.


In the FA Cup match against Southampton, Dans made his first appearance for Liverpool's first team and contributed 2 goals. In last month's game, Dans scored again for Liverpool, allowing coach Arne Sloter to see his potential.


Slotte once praised Dans' potential, saying: "Like other academy players, he always gives his all. If your mentality is like this, you can definitely achieve your maximum potential, which is what he will experience."


"It may take some time to see how much potential he has and whether he can eventually become our starter. But I am very sure that with his mentality, he will have a very successful career."


In Liverpool's Champions League away game against PSV Eindhoven, Dans made his first start and also played in the Champions League for the first time. Now in order to let Dans accumulate more experience, Liverpool loaned him to Sunderland.


Sunderland currently has 58 points in the Championship, ranking fourth, 5 points behind Leeds United, which is in first place. I hope Dans can learn in the Championship and help Sunderland win more games.
